Battery Disposal. Lithium-ion batteries are household hazardous waste and should never be placed in the garbage, Blue Bin (recycling) or Green Bin (organics). Bring lithium-ion batteries to one of the City’s Drop-Off Depots or a Community Environment Day for safe disposal.. Jun 7, 2023 · EPA issued guidance on the potential applicability of the nation’s hazardous waste regulatory program under RCRA to the collection and recycling of lithium-ion batteries. The new guidance document may be useful to persons generating or handling used lithium-ion batteries or devices containing such batteries, as it summarizes, consolidates, and clarifies some of the complex rules and guidance ... (lithium, other ...For lithium-ion batteries, place each individual battery in a separate clear plastic bag. For all other household batteries, use clear packing tape, electrical tape or duct tape across the ends of the batteries to prevent battery ends from touching one another or striking against metal surfaces, then place the batteries in a clear plastic bag for transport, disposal or …battery recycling. This, in turn, helps to create jobs and ... , How to safely store and drop off used batteries. Cover the terminals of used batteries with clear sticky tape or duct tape, to prevent sparking and reduce the risk of fire. Store them in a glass container and make sure the container is not airtight. Don’t keep batteries in a metal container or together with other metal objects., Repco is a convenient place to take your battery for disposal.
